  • COURT OF APPEALS OF VIRGINIA Present: Judges Benton, Humphreys and Senior Judge Overton DOMINION VIRGINIA POWER MEMORANDUM OPINION* v. Record No. 1789-05-1 PER CURIAM NOVEMBER 22, 2005 CLYDE M. FARR FROM THE VIRGINIA WORKERS’ COMPENSATION COMMISSION (Arthur T. Aylward; Iris W. Redmond; Midkiff, Muncie & Ross, P.C., on brief), for appellant. (John H. Klein; Charlene Parker Brown; Montagna Klein Camden, LLP, on brief), for appellee. Dominion Virginia Power appeals a decision of the Workers’ Compensation Commission ruling that Clyde M. Farr proved that his July 1, 2002 injury by accident caused his right carpal tunnel syndrome. We have reviewed the record and the commission’s opinion and hold that this appeal is without merit. Accordingly, we affirm the commission’s decision for the reasons stated by the commission in its final opinion. See Farr v. Dominion Virginia Power, VWC File No. 213-92-83 (June 22, 2005). We dispense with oral argument and summarily affirm because the facts and legal contentions are adequately presented in the materials before the Court and argument would not aid the decisional process. See Code § 17.1-403; Rule 5A:27. Affirmed. * Pursuant to Code § 17.1-413, this opinion is not designated for publication.
